Easy to maintain

If  free standing electric fireplace heater with mantel  planning to install an electric fireplace in your living room, it's crucial to select one that is easy to maintain. Electric fireplaces are a good option because they don't require to be cleaned or have ash removed. They can be cleaned by wiping them with a damp cloth. In addition, they don't produce any kind of combustion, which lowers the possibility of carbon monoxide and fire poisoning within your home.

The most efficient method to maintain your fireplace mounted on a wall is to connect it to an electrical outlet that is grounded and follow the instructions of the manufacturer. Make sure the unit is not in direct contact with open flames or flammable objects and doesn't block windows or doors. Also, be aware of any existing air intakes or vents within your home, and make sure that the in-wall fire place is compatible with these.

Ethanol fireplaces are a great option for wall-mounted installations. They're powered by liquid bioethanol and don't require ventilation or gas pipes. They don't emit odors or emit smoke and can be used throughout the year. They're the ideal solution for homes where space is limited.
